Subjects who have not died by the analysis data cutoff date will be censored at their last contact date.'}]}, 'oversightModule': {'oversightHasDmc': False, 'isFdaRegulatedDrug': False, 'isFdaRegulatedDevice': False}, 'conditionsModule': {'keywords': ['Axi-cel retreatment, R/R LBCL'], 'conditions': ['CAR-T Retreatment']}, 'descriptionModule': {'briefSummary': "This is a prospective, single-arm, clinical study to explore the efficacy and safety of Axi-cel retreatment in R/R LBCL in Shanghai Ruijin Hospital in China.\n\nR/R LBCL patients who treated with Axi-cel got non-CR or relapsed were eligible for Axi-cel retreatment in this study. Patients will receive the standard dose of Axi-cel and follow the standard process. Other related treatment like bridging therapy or combination therapy will be based on patients status and investigators' decision. The primary endpoint is ORR, the secondary endpoint is CR, PR, DOR, PFS, OS and AE. A total of 32 patients is planned to be enrolled in this study. The trial will not go on if nobody got CR or PR in first 6 patients.", 'detailedDescription': "This study is a prospective, single-arm, open-label two-stage study. There were 6 cases enrolled in Phase 1 and 26 cases enrolled in Phase 2, for a total of 32 cases.\n\nThis study aimed to collect data on efficacy and safety after secondary infusion treatment with aquilencel in adult patients with r/r LBCL after the first treatment of CD19 CAR-T. No form of grouping was performed in this study, and subgroup analyses were performed based on the actual data collected.\n\nResearch Process:\n\nThe patient has been evaluated for disease after the first treatment of akilencel, and the investigator decided to give the patient a second treatment based on clinical practice.
